The most unpredictable group in the 2026 World Cup qualifiers

Group A of the 2026 World Cup qualifiers in Europe sees three teams, Germany, Northern Ireland and Slovakia, tied on points.

Germany is leading Group A. Photo: Reuters .

In the early morning of October 11, Germany defeated Luxembourg 4-0, while Northern Ireland won 2-0 against Slovakia. The result left Germany, Northern Ireland and Slovakia all with 6 points, but Germany topped the group thanks to the best goal difference.

The recent series of matches shows that Group A has the most unpredictable situation in the 2026 World Cup qualifiers in Europe. With a squad of top players who are mainstays at big clubs, Germany is still a strong candidate for a direct ticket to the 2026 World Cup.

If Germany continues to play consistently, they will likely maintain their top position until the end of the qualifying round and qualify directly. However, the German team's performance has not been convincing. In the opening match of the qualifying round, coach Julian Nagelsmann and his team lost 0-2 away to Slovakia. Therefore, fans of "Die Mannschaft" cannot rest assured.

Northern Ireland and Slovakia are likely to battle it out for second place in the play-offs, a match that is considered a do-or-die affair, as neither team is allowed to drop points against the lowest-ranked team in the group, Luxembourg.

Group A is entering an unpredictable and dramatic phase where just one draw can change the entire situation of the group.
